[新手上路]批处理新手入门导读[视频教程]批处理基础视频教程[视频教程]VBS基础视频教程[批处理精品]批处理版照片整理器
[批处理精品]纯批处理备份&还原驱动[批处理精品]CMD命令50条不能说的秘密[在线下载]第三方命令行工具[在线帮助]VBScript / JScript 在线参考
返回列表 发帖

[问题求助] if语句的一个问题[已解决]

本帖最后由 czjt1234 于 2012-4-13 14:59 编辑
  1. Dim fso,yn,ttfile
  2. Set fso = CreateObject("Scripting.FileSystemObject")
  3. yn = fso.FileExists("D:\test.txt")
  4. msgbox yn,64
  5. if yn then
  6. set ttfile = fso.GetFile("D:\test.txt")
  7. ttfile.delete
  8. end if
复制代码
这样可以删除文件
  1. Dim fso,yn,ttfile
  2. Set fso = CreateObject("Scripting.FileSystemObject")
  3. yn = fso.FileExists("D:\test.txt")
  4. msgbox yn,64
  5. if yn = 1  then
  6. set ttfile = fso.GetFile("D:\test.txt")
  7. ttfile.delete
  8. end if
复制代码
用 yn = 1 就执行不了了
咋的?
1

评分人数

    • broly: 感谢给帖子标题标注[已解决]字样PB + 2

if yn = true then
1

评分人数

TOP

TRUE=-1,False=0

IF yn=-1 then或者 IF yn<>0 then
1

评分人数

    • broly: 乐于助人技术 + 1

TOP

谢谢~~~~~~~~~~~~

TOP

返回列表